A specialist in the music of Granados, Riva is the Assistant Director of the 18 volume critical edition of the Complete Works for Piano of Enrique Granados, directed by Alicia de Larrocha and published by Editorial Boileau, Barcelona, 2001, which is the first complete catalog of the composer's works for piano.
